基于BMI的状态反馈对角优势化

摘    要:提出了一种针对线性定常系统的状态反馈对角优势化方法.基于系统的H2范数定义了系统在整个频域内的对角优势,并采用线性矩阵不等式(LMI)描述,给出了系统具有所定义对角优势度的充要条件.在此基础上,将状态反馈对角优势化转化为双线性矩阵不等式(BMI)问题,给出了采用双重迭代法求解该BMI问题的步骤,通过求解BMI可得到最优常数反馈矩阵.仿真结果表明采用该方法能降低系统的耦合程度.

关 键 词:线性矩阵不等式(LMI)  双线性矩阵不等式(BMI)  H2范数  解耦  对角优势  伪对角化

BMI-based state feedback diagonalization
